For auction is a lot of 4 cigarette lighters from Las Vegas. I think they are all from the 60's but I'm not sure about that. The lighter at the top left is 14kt gold plated souvenier of the Mint Hotel before it was completed in 1965; photos #11 and 12 show the paper that originally came with the lighter. It is a really nice piece of Las Vegas history. The lighter on the upper right, also from the Mint Hotel, has crackle on the finish. It is all there, but it is just a bit rough looking. The lighter on the bottom left is from the Sands Hotel which was demolished on October 25, 2006. The fourth lighter was made in Japan. One side is a map of the state of Nevada; tho other side is a picture of downtown Las Vegas Fremont Street the way it looked in the 1960's. All the lighters are in good working condition......all you have to do is add fluid and flint. The pictures do a good job of showing the condition of the lighters.
